Committee hears BEST Act to clarify and expand coverage for supplemental breast screenings

Representative Jean Schmidt and Representative Josh Williams testified in favor of House Bill 271, the BEST Act, telling the House Insurance Committee the bill would clarify and expand insurance coverage for supplemental breast screenings and remove out-of-pocket costs for patients.

"The BEST Act will alleviate these problems," Schmidt said, explaining the bill "clarifies the definitions of supplemental screenings and diagnostic screenings to prevent miscoding or misidentifying the type of screening and coverage of supplemental screenings intended in House Bill 3 71."
